Which of the following conditions must be met in order to make a statistical inference about a population based on a sample if t

he sample does not come from a normally distributed population?
Mathematics
2 answers:
Sav [38]3 years ago
7 0
N is greater than or equal to 30 would be the condition that must be met in order to make a statistical inference about a population based on a sample if the sample does not come from a normally distributed population.

Write each of the following numerals in base 10. For base twelve, T and E represent the face values ten and eleven, respectively
uysha [10]

(a)

421₅ = 4×5² + 2×5¹ + 1×5⁰

… = 100 + 10 + 1

… = 111

(b)

11101₂ = 1×2⁴ + 1×2³ + 1×2² + 0×2¹ + 1×2⁰

… = 16 + 8 + 4 + 0 + 1

… = 29

(c)

13T₁₂ = 1×12² + 3×12¹ + 10×12⁰

… = 144 + 36 + 10

… = 190
